What Shapes What We Eat and Drink – and Why It Matters

It’s never been a better time to be a food lover. We binge Bake Off, follow foodie influencers, queue for trending hotspots and scroll endlessly for ideas on what to cook next. But for all this appetite, how much do we really know about what goes on behind the scenes with our food? And what can we really do to change things?

That’s where this book comes in.

In Good Taste is a guide to the issues shaping our edible world today. It’s not exhaustive and it’s not meant to be preachy – it’s a starting point to help us see the bigger picture and find our place in it.

Starting with a bird’s eye view of how the food system works (and why it urgently needs transforming), the book then covers:

  • The players: Who holds the power, makes decisions and to what extent, and what food policy means for our everyday lives.
  • The people: How global trade and colonisation created inequality and continue to shape what we eat – and who gets left behind.
  • The planet: How we got here and what’s at stake for the environment and the climate.
  • Positive, practical change: Tangible ways food lovers can make an impact with what’s on our plates and beyond.

If enough of us take an interest, we become powerful ingredients in making a difference in what matters in food and drink today.

About the author

Mallika Basu is a writer, presenter and commentator on food, drink and hospitality, with a firm belief in the power of food as a force for good. A features writer and presenter for Good Food, she explores planet-friendlier eating and the links between food, people and the planet in her award-nominated newsletter, In Good Taste.

Mallika is the author of two Indian cookbooks, Miss Masala and Masala, a recipe writer and a regular speaker and chair at food events across the UK. She educates curious eaters about food systems and food writing at the British Library, and is a finale judge and co-presenter of the Guild of Fine Food’s Great Taste Awards, reviewing entries for its ethical and sustainable bursary.

Alongside her food writing, Mallika has over 20 years of strategic communications and advisory expertise, having worked with organisations including Jamie Oliver Group and Waitrose. She also helped shape Borough Market’s 2030 strategy. She has completed the Sustainable Food: Production and Processing programme at the University of Cambridge Institute for Sustainability Leadership (CISL) and holds a master’s degree in journalism.

Born in Kolkata, India, Mallika lives in South London with her two teenage children.
